Pros

(Possible pro’s) Depending on where you are you could have a nice team. You do get discounts on holidays (not generous) this goes up each year you’ve worked for the company if you can survive that long.

Cons

I honestly do not know how there are good reviews on here. The company does not care about you as an individual, it only cares about how much money you make for them. The commission is disgusting, for every £1000 you take in, you will get £3 commission. So if you sell a £2000 Holiday you will ONLY get £6. They have lowered commission in the busy period (Jan/Feb) so they don’t spend a lot of money on our commissions. In the quiet period you will be lucky to take home £20 extra, oh and you only get commissions if you hit your unrealistic targets so most of the time you won’t get anything for your hard work. They expect A LOT from every employee, not only is it selling holidays but you have to sell 100 extras and if you forget one then you’re in trouble. All of this hard work for the worst salary, full timers averagely get £12,500pa, you probably get more working in a supermarket that doesn’t give you the pressure. They bribe you to work harder for pay rises and say you can get up to 10% pay rise dependent on your rank in the company, a few employees I know we’re super sellers (in the top 50 out of thousands) and they got a 1% pay rise! Hard work doesn’t pay off in this company. Overall it’s poorly paid, not many benefits and get empty promises from the company, I still work here but am desperately trying to leave so please don’t waste your time!!!

Pros

Great products and really engaged people. Most people stay at TUI, many of whom have been there for 30 years! Product is great, and the company does really well in dealing with global crises (which seem to happen every year).

Cons

Slow development of tech. Takes years to develop anything, by which time the market has already been disrupted. Has a very loyal customer base, which is how it gets away with it, but as technology becomes more important to doing business, will need to improve in this area.
